Elderly Sitter Services: When Is It Time to Hire Help?
An elderly sitter may be appropriate when an older adult needs companionship, routine check-ins, light non-medical support, or supervision but does not require ongoing hands-on or clinical care. Families may also consider sitter support when caregiving schedules become difficult to maintain or an older loved one spends long periods alone.
